Visualizzazione dei risultati da 1 a 2 su 2
  1. #1

    Visualizzare Il Form Solo Se La Query Seleziona Almeno Un Record

    Salve a tutti,

    chi mi può aiutare a risolvere questo problemino ??

    In breve avrei la necessità di visualizzare il form solo se la query seleziona almeno un record:

    Il codice che ho e che devo condizionare è il seguente:
    Codice PHP:
    <form method="post" action="invia.php"><INPUT NAME="op" TYPE="hidden" VALUE="send">
      <table>
          <tr>
            <td></td>
            <td>N&deg; Ordine: 
            <input name="nordine" type="text" value="<? echo $nordine ?>" size="10" maxlength="5" readonly="true"></td>
            <td>E-mail utilizzata nell'ordine:        </td>
            <td colspan="6"><input name="email" type="text" size="30" maxlength="150">          <div align="center"></div>          <div align="center"></div>          <div align="center"></div>          <div align="center"></div>          <div align="center"></div></td>
          </tr>
        <tr>
          <td colspan="9"><font size="2"> Scala di giudizio: [b]5-[/b] Ottimo; [b]4-[/b] Buono; [b]3-[/b] Sufficiente; [b]2-[/b] insufficiente; [b]1-[/b] scarso </font> </td>
        </tr>
        <tr>
          <td><font size="2">[b]Nr.[/b]</font></td>
          <td colspan="3"><font size="2">[b]Elemento di giudizio[/b]</font></td>
          <td align="center"><div align="center">[b]1[/b]</div></td>
          <td align="center"><div align="center">[b]2[/b]</div></td>
          <td align="center"><div align="center">[b]3[/b]</div></td>
          <td align="center"><div align="center">[b]4[/b]</div></td>
          <td align="center"><div align="center">[b]5[/b]</div></td>
        </tr>
        <tr>
          <td align="right" height="30">[b]1.[/b]</td>
          <td height="30" colspan="3"><font size="2"><?php echo $nome_feedback01?></font></td>
          <td height="30"><div align="center">
            <input type="radio" value="1" name="feedback01"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="2" name="feedback01"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="3" name="feedback01"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="4" name="feedback01"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="5" name="feedback01" />
          </div></td>
        </tr>
        <tr>
          <td align="right" height="30">[b]2.[/b]</td>
          <td height="30" colspan="3"><font size="2"><?php echo $nome_feedback02?></font></td>
          <td height="30"><div align="center">
            <input type="radio" value="1" name="feedback02"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="2" name="feedback02"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="3" name="feedback02"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="4" name="feedback02"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="5" name="feedback02" />
          </div></td>
        </tr>
        <tr>
          <td align="right" height="30">[b]3.[/b]</td>
          <td height="30" colspan="3"><font size="2"><?php echo $nome_feedback03?></font></td>
          <td height="30"><div align="center">
            <input type="radio" value="1" name="feedback03"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="2" name="feedback03"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="3" name="feedback03"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="4" name="feedback03"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="5" name="feedback03" />
          </div></td>
        </tr>
        <tr>
          <td align="right" height="30">[b]4.[/b]</td>
          <td height="30" colspan="3"><font size="2"><?php echo $nome_feedback04?></font></td>
          <td height="30"><div align="center">
            <input type="radio" value="1" name="feedback04"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="2" name="feedback04"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="3" name="feedback04"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="4" name="feedback04"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="5" name="feedback04" />
          </div></td>
        </tr>
        <tr>
          <td align="right" height="30">[b]5.[/b]</td>
          <td height="30" colspan="3"><font size="2"><?php echo $nome_feedback05?></font></td>
          <td height="30"><div align="center">
            <input type="radio" value="1" name="feedback05"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="2" name="feedback05"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="3" name="feedback05"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="4" name="feedback05"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="5" name="feedback05" />
          </div></td>
        </tr>
        <tr>
          <td align="right" height="30">[b]6.[/b]</td>
          <td height="30" colspan="3"><font size="2"><?php echo $nome_feedback06?></font></td>
          <td height="30"><div align="center">
            <input type="radio" value="1" name="feedback06"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="2" name="feedback06"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="3" name="feedback06"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="4" name="feedback06"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="5" name="feedback06" />
          </div></td>
        </tr>
        <tr>
          <td align="right" height="30">[b]7.[/b]</td>
          <td height="30" colspan="3"><font size="2"> <?php echo $nome_feedback07?></font></td>
          <td height="30"><div align="center">
            <input type="radio" value="1" name="feedback07"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="2" name="feedback07"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="3" name="feedback07"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="4" name="feedback07"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="5" name="feedback07" />
          </div></td>
        </tr>
        <tr>
          <td align="right" height="30">[b]8.[/b]</td>
          <td height="30" colspan="3"><font size="2"><?php echo $nome_feedback08?></font></td>
          <td height="30"><div align="center">
            <input type="radio" value="1" name="feedback08"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="2" name="feedback08"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="3" name="feedback08"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="4" name="feedback08"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="5" name="feedback08" />
          </div></td>
        </tr>
        <tr>
          <td align="right" height="30">[b]9.[/b]</td>
          <td height="30" colspan="3"><font size="2"><?php echo $nome_feedback09?></font></td>
          <td height="30"><div align="center">
            <input type="radio" value="1" name="feedback09"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="2" name="feedback09"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="3" name="feedback09"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="4" name="feedback09" />
          </div></td>
          <td height="30"><div align="center">
            <input type="radio" value="5" name="feedback09" />
          </div></td>
        </tr>
        <tr>
          <td align="right" height="30">[b]10.[/b]</td>
          <td height="30" colspan="3"><font size="2"><?php echo $nome_feedback10?></font></td>
          <td height="30"><div align="center">
            Si:</div></td>
          <td height="30"><div align="center">
            <input type="radio" value="Si" name="feedback10" />
          </div></td>
          <td height="30"><div align="center">
            No:</div></td>
          <td height="30"><div align="center">
            <input type="radio" value="No" name="feedback10" />
          </div></td>
          <td height="30"><div align="center">
          </div></td>
        </tr>
        <tr>
          <td></td>
          <td colspan="3"></td>
          <td><div align="center"></div></td>
          <td><div align="center"></div></td>
          <td><div align="center"></div></td>
          <td><div align="center"></div></td>
          <td><div align="center"></div></td>
        </tr>
        <tr>
          <td valign="top"></td>
          <td colspan="8" valign="top">

    Note e Suggerimenti:</p>        <textarea name="message" cols="60" rows="3"></textarea>        <div align="center"></div>        <div align="center"></div></td>
        </tr>
        <tr>
          <td></td>
          <td><input name="submit" type="submit" value="Invia"></td> 
          <td colspan="2"></td>
          <td><div align="center"></div></td>
        <td><div align="center"></div></td>
        <td><div align="center"></div></td>
        <td><div align="center"></div></td>
        <td><div align="center"></div></td>
        </tr>
      </table>
    Avevo pernsato ad una soluzione del genere:

    Prima del codice inserisco
    <? include("config.inc.php"); //collego e seleziono il db

    $query = "select * from ordini WHERE inviatofeedack= 1";


    A questo punto come faccio a dirgli che se non trova nulla deve inserire la scritta "non trovato"

    Ringrazio tutti coloro che mi vorranno aiutare
    Danilo

  2. #2
    Fai

    Codice PHP:
    $query "select * from ordini WHERE inviatofeedack= 1";
    $result mysql_query($query$db);
    $count mysql_num_rows($result);

    if(
    $count == 0)
    {
      echo 
    "NON HO TROVATO NIENTE";


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.